Target Group
This course explores how Agile principles, tools, and techniques can be applied to business change initiatives. It is designed for experienced business analysts and professionals working in change and transformation roles who wish to develop their understanding of Agile practices in a business context. Learners will examine how business analysts contribute within Agile frameworks and engage with Agile methods including user stories, functional modelling, backlogs, and prioritisation.
By the end of the course, participants will have developed practical strategies for working as an Agile business analyst and will be prepared to sit the BCS Professional Certificate in Agile Business Analysis exam.

Prerequisites
Learners should have prior knowledge equivalent to the BCS International Diploma in Business Analysis or the BCS Solutions Development Diploma. Familiarity with techniques such as CATWOE, Business Activity Modelling, and Use Case Diagrams is expected.
Target audience
This course is suitable for experienced business analysts, business architects, business managers, and project managers seeking to deepen their understanding of Agile philosophies and methodologies in the context of business analysis. It is also intended for those working toward the BCS Advanced Diploma in Business Analysis who already hold the International Diploma.

Exams and assessments
This course includes a BCS Professional Certificate in Agile Business Analysis exam voucher. The exam is a one-hour, closed-book, multiple-choice assessment via remote proctor. Learners must schedule the exam to take place after the course. The exam voucher expires 12 months after confirmed attendance of the course.
Hands-on learning
Throughout the course, learners will engage with real-world case studies, collaborative discussions, and guided exercises. Practical tools such as storyboards, Kanban boards, and backlog prioritisation will be used to simulate Agile working environments and enhance applied understanding.
